The White Longhorns will square off against the Sunset Bison at 6:30 p.m. on Friday. Both teams are coming into the game red-hot, with White sitting on seven straight wins and Sunset on five.
Last Tuesday, White took their contest with ease, bagging a 73-3 victory over Molina. The Longhorns have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won 12 matches by 21 points or more this season.
Meanwhile, Sunset beat South Oak Cliff 52-41 on Tuesday.
Sunset is also on a roll lately: they've won 15 of their last 16 games, which provided a nice bump to their 22-8 record this season. The wins came thanks to their defensive effort, having only surrendered 24.0 points per game. As for White, their win was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 14-9.
Everything came up roses for White against Sunset in their previous matchup on January 7th, as the squad secured a 71-26 victory. Will White repeat their success, or does Sunset have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
